Top 5 NFT Games on iOS in Slovakia: Q1 2025 Performance

In the first quarter of 2025, the NFT gaming landscape in Slovakia on the iOS platform showcased some interesting trends. Here's a closer look at the performance of the top five NFT games, with data sourced from Sensor Tower.

IMVU: Fun 3D Avatar Chat Game saw a varied performance throughout the quarter. Weekly revenue fluctuated, peaking at around $177 in early January and experiencing a dip mid-quarter before recovering slightly. Weekly downloads were mostly stable, with a minor increase to 24 in late February. Active users showed a gradual decline from 169 to 146 by the end of March.

Age of Apes had a steady decrease in active users, starting with 58 and ending with 37. Revenue showed a consistent pattern, with a high of $249 at the start of the quarter and minor fluctuations thereafter.

Million Lords: World Conquest maintained a relatively low active user base, with numbers holding steady at 4 throughout much of the quarter. Revenue saw significant variation, reaching a high of $156 in mid-January.

Auto Brawl Chess:Battle Royale experienced a gradual decline in active users, starting at 40 and dropping to 22 by the end of March. Revenue was more consistent, with a slight peak of $85 in mid-February.

Finally, COIN: Always Be Earning showed minimal activity in terms of downloads and active users. Revenue, however, peaked at $147 in mid-March, indicating sporadic high engagement.
